How to fill out correctionamendment affidavit for candidateofficeholder

Illustration

How to fill out correctionamendment affidavit for candidateofficeholder

01
Start by obtaining the correction/amendment affidavit form from the relevant election office or online portal.
02
Read the instructions carefully to understand the purpose of the affidavit.
03
Fill out your personal information, including your name, address, and the office for which you are a candidate or officeholder.
04
Clearly identify the information that needs correction or amendment; provide the original details and the corrected information.
05
Include an explanation for the correction or amendment, if required.
06
Sign and date the affidavit to certify that the information provided is accurate.
07
Submit the completed affidavit form to the appropriate election office along with any required documentation.

Who needs correctionamendment affidavit for candidateofficeholder?

01
Candidates or officeholders who have filed incorrect information on their initial nomination papers or official documents related to their candidacy.
02
Individuals whose circumstances have changed after filing and need to update their information.
03
Candidates who want to clarify or correct any misleading or erroneous information in their official filings.

Understanding the Correction Amendment Affidavit for Candidate/Officeholder Form

Understanding the correction amendment affidavit

A correction amendment affidavit for candidate/officeholder form serves a pivotal role in ensuring the integrity and accuracy of electoral processes. This affidavit is essentially a legal document that allows candidates and officeholders to amend previously submitted information to rectify any inaccuracies. The primary purpose of filing this affidavit is to ensure that official records accurately reflect current and truthful information regarding an individual’s candidacy or officeholding.

Maintaining accurate records is not merely a bureaucratic requirement; it has profound legal implications. Inaccuracies or discrepancies in filings can lead to disqualification from elections, challenges to candidacies, or even legal repercussions. Therefore, it’s crucial for candidates and officials to be vigilant in maintaining up-to-date information.

Changes in personal information, such as name, address, or contact details.
Corrections due to clerical errors in previously submitted forms.
Specific requirements dictated by local jurisdictions regarding filing amendments.

Key components of the correction amendment affidavit

The correctness of information in the correction amendment affidavit is crucial. Essential information required on this form includes the candidate's or officeholder's personal identification details, which may encompass full name, current address, and identification number, depending on the jurisdiction. Additionally, the form must clearly articulate the specific details of the amendments being requested, highlighting the discrepancies and providing accurate replacements where necessary.

The structure of the form comprises several identifiable sections that guide the candidate through the process. Sections typically include personal details, a description of the corrections needed, and signature verification. To ensure clarity and successful processing, it’s advisable to use straightforward language and avoid convoluted descriptions.

Personal identification details.
Description of the corrections.
Notarization requirements.
Signatures and dates.

Step-by-step guide to completing the correction amendment affidavit

Before filling out the correction amendment affidavit, candidates should gather all necessary documentation. This includes valid identification, any previously submitted forms, and records of the discrepancies that prompted the amendment. It’s essential to determine the appropriate jurisdiction for submission, as filing requirements may vary significantly based on local laws.

Filling out the affidavit should be approached methodically. Start by providing personal details, ensuring accuracy to prevent further amendments. Next, clearly describe the corrections, specifying what information is incorrect and how it should read post-correction. Many jurisdictions require notarization; thus, be prepared to have the document notarized before submission. Finally, ensure all signatures and dates are included, stressing the importance of accuracy in every section to avoid unnecessary delays.

Personal details: Full name, address, and contact number.
Description of corrections: What is incorrect and how it should be amended.
Notarization requirements: Ensure the document is notarized if required.
Signatures and dates: Double-check for completeness.

Candidates should be aware of common mistakes to avoid during this process. Inaccuracies in personal details, neglecting to notarize when required, and failing to include all necessary signatures can lead to rejection of the affidavit. Being proactive in checking compliance with local regulations can save significant time and frustration.

Managing your correction amendment affidavit after submission

Once the correction amendment affidavit has been submitted, it’s essential to track its progress. Many jurisdictions provide online platforms where candidates can confirm their submission status. Following up with the relevant election office can ensure that there are no unexpected delays and that all necessary information has been processed accurately.

After submission, candidates should be prepared for various outcomes. Processing times for amendments can vary, and candidates may either receive acceptance of the amendment or be notified of issues requiring further action. Understanding these potential results can better equip candidates to handle next steps, such as resubmitting corrections or addressing issues raised by the election office.

Confirm submission via online platforms or direct communication.
Understand processing times and what to expect.
Be prepared for next steps based on acceptance or rejection.

A correction/amendment affidavit for a candidate or officeholder is a legal document that formally rectifies or modifies information previously filed in a campaign finance report or similar paperwork. It is used to ensure that all disclosures and statements are accurate.
Candidates and officeholders who have submitted campaign finance reports or similar documents containing errors or omissions are required to file a correction/amendment affidavit.
To fill out a correction/amendment affidavit, the individual must clearly identify the original filing, specify the corrections being made, provide accurate updated information, and sign the affidavit. It often requires adherence to specific formatting guidelines set by the relevant election authority.
The purpose of the correction/amendment affidavit is to ensure transparency and accuracy in campaign finance reporting, allowing candidates and officeholders to correct any discrepancies or inaccuracies in their filings.
The information reported on a correction/amendment affidavit typically includes the original filing details, the specific errors being corrected, the corrected information, a signature of the candidate or officeholder, and any other required identifying information as mandated by election authorities.
